Road Kill (noun) Definition, Meaning & Examples

noun
  1. the body of an animal killed on a road by a motor vehicle.
noun
  1. the remains of an animal or animals killed on the road by motor vehicles
Road Kill (noun) Definition, Meaning & Examples

More Definitions